Overview
In most organizations, accessing data is a fragmented process hidden in emails, chat messages, or generic tickets. These tools grant access but fail to capture the crucial business context: why is the data needed and how will it be used? This leaves governance teams with a significant blind spot, unable to track the true value and usage patterns of their data assets.
Blindata’s Data Product Marketplace transforms this chaos into a streamlined, transparent experience—like an internal App Store for your data. It acts as a central hub where data consumers can easily discover, understand, and request access to certified data products.
For data consumers, this means no more guesswork. They can find what they need, understand its context and quality, and submit access requests in a few clicks, dramatically accelerating their projects.
For data producers and governance teams, the marketplace provides what security and ticketing tools can’t: a rich, auditable record of data consumption. By tracking not just who has access but also their intended use, you gain invaluable metadata on how data is leveraged across the business. This closes the governance loop, ensures compliance, and provides the feedback needed to create even better data products.

How To
Stop searching through outdated wikis or asking colleagues where to find data. The marketplace acts as a central, trusted storefront for all your organization’s data products. You can browse by business domain, filter by tags, and assess data quality at a glance. Each listing is enriched with comprehensive metadata, including ownership, lineage, and service-level objectives, so you can confidently find and trust the right data for your needs in minutes, not days.
Move beyond generic tickets that lack context. When you find a data product, you can initiate an access request directly from its page. The structured form prompts you to specify not just what you need (which data ports), but also why you need it—your business use case. This clarity helps data owners make faster, more informed approval decisions and creates a detailed, auditable history of data intent that is invaluable for governance and compliance.
No more wondering about the status of your data request in a black-box ticketing system. Once submitted, you can follow your request’s journey in real time, from submission to approval. Data product owners are automatically notified to review your request, and you receive updates as its status changes. This transparent, end-to-end workflow eliminates ambiguity and the need for follow-up emails, letting you focus on your work.
Business needs are not static, and your data access should adapt with them. As projects evolve, the original purpose for accessing data may expand. For example, a dataset initially approved for departmental reporting might now be needed for a new, cross-functional machine learning initiative. The marketplace allows you to transparently update your subscription with this new business justification, ensuring the data’s use remains aligned with its approved purpose.
This agility also empowers data governance. When policies change or new compliance information is required, like completing a survey to classify data sensitivity, producers can request updates from all active consumers. This ensures your data usage records are always current and compliant without the hassle of re-issuing every permission from scratch. And when a project concludes, access can be revoked with a single click, maintaining a secure and clean data environment.

Automate your end-to-end access control workflows by connecting the marketplace to your tech stack. Blindata provides a simple, event-driven API that sends real-time notifications whenever access is granted, modified, or revoked. Use these subscription events to trigger actions in your other systems, such as:
Automatically provisioning permissions in your data platform of choice.
Creating or closing tickets in your preferred tool.
Updating user groups in your identity provider (IdP).
This ensures the governance decisions made in the marketplace are instantly and consistently enforced across your entire data ecosystem, eliminating manual steps and closing compliance gaps.
